Poltava vs Yokohama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Poltava, Ukraine and Yokohama, Japan is approximately 8,040 km or 4,996 mi.
  • To reach Poltava in this distance one would set out from Yokohama bearing 318.9°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Poltava bearing 235.7° or SW .
  • Poltava has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Yokohama has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Poltava is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Yokohama is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 7.7 °C (13.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.4 °C (9.7°F) more in Poltava.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1000 mm (39.4 in) less which is equivalent to 1000 l/m² (24.54 US gal/ft²) or 10,000,000 l/ha (1,069,066 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.2° lower in Poltava than in Yokohama.
